Web27 Dec 2012 · Scientists believe there are over 200 different kinds of owls around the world. Almost 20 species of owls can be found in North America alone. Today, owls can be found on every continent except Antarctica. Owls can range in size from the very small elf owl (five inches tall) to the two-foot-tall great gray owl. Web13 Dec 2024 · Common Names: Barn and bay owls, true owls. Basic Animal Group: Bird. Size: Wingspans from 13–52 inches. Weight: 1.4 ounces to 4 pounds. Lifespan: 1–30 years. Diet: Carnivore. Habitat: Every continent except Antarctica, most environments. Conservation Status: Most owls are listed as Least Concerned, but a few are Endangered or Critically ...
